The consumer-packaged goods (CPG) industry faces volatility, compounding risks from financial stability, logistics, and shifting demand. Traditional procurement approaches are hampered by slow data analysis and reactive responses. As AI adoption in the CPG sector accelerates, slated to reach $1.3 trillion by 2029, agentic AI systems are emerging as proactive digital procurement workers. These systems monitor in real-time, providing actionable insights and recommendations, thus transforming procurement from a manual, fragmented process to an agile, responsive one.

Key areas of impact include strategic sourcing, supplier risk management, and contract compliance. AI agents continuously analyze data, highlighting risks and opportunities well before crises arise. To maximize their effectiveness, organizations must evolve their governance strategies, ensuring ongoing oversight of AI deployment. By embedding AI into workflows, mid-sized CPG brands can outpace larger competitors burdened by legacy systems. Future procurement success will depend on leveraging AI for continuous action in complex supply networks.
